才子佳人博客

我的故事我讲述

com.mysql.jdbc.NonRegisteringDriver.connect异常解决办法
 
来源:xjh  编辑:xjh  2008-03-13
环境说明:linux,tomcat,mysql

异常:
java.sql.DriverManager.getConnection(DriverManager.java:207)
com.mysql.jdbc.NonRegisteringDriver.connect(NonRegisteringDriver.java:266)

原因分析:错误出于下面两句话,说明找不到合适的mysql驱动

Class.forName(Configure.DRV);
conn=DriverManager.getConnection(Configure.URL);

解决办法:
1)拷贝mysql-connector-java-3.1.14-bin.jar包文件到/usr/local/lib目录下

cd/usr/local/lib
cpmysql-connector-java-3.1.14-bin.jar

然后查看并且设置类路径
echodollar CLASSPATH
:/usr/java/jdk1.6.0/lib:/usr/local/lib/mysql-connector-java-3.1.14-bin.jar

2)拷贝mysql-connector-java-3.1.14-bin.jar包文件到tomcat6.0/lib/目录下

3)重启动tomcat

分类:编程开发| 查看评论
相关文章
文章点击排行
本年度文章点击排行
发表评论:
  • 昵称: *
  • 邮箱: *
  • 网址:
  • 评论:(最多100字)
  • 验证码: